Elisiva Lu’isa Mani Sandness, a.k.a. “Lu” (Isa) passed away peacefully with her family by her side and returned home to her Heavenly Father on January 22, 2019 after a courageous battle with liver failure. The family would like to thank Dr. Brown and the entire medical team at Intermountain Healthcare Hospital in Murray for their caring professionalism.
Luisa was born to the late Epalahame Toakai Mani and Teisa Pakofe Mani on May 19, 1966 in Ha’atafu, Tonga. Luisa graduated from West Jordan High School and faithfully served a full-time LDS mission in Long Beach, CA from 1982-1983.
She married the love of her life, Bryan Sandness on September 19, 2008. They have lived in Vernal, UT for 10 years. She is survived by her husband Bryan and five beautiful children: Charlie, Crystal, Candice, Tait and Tavish; and five precious grandchildren: Mason, Andrew, Mikayla, Addison and Ethan. She is also survived by her mother, Pakofe Mani, and many loving sisters, brothers, nieces, nephews.
Luisa dedicated her life to serving and loving her family and everyone she crossed paths with. She poured her heart into everything she committed her time to, including her work as a chef, caregiver and serving the Lord in the Vernal LDS Temple. She had a passion for cooking, canning and fishing. You could always find her in any kitchen wearing her favorite apron ready to serve others. She had the biggest, contagious smile and laugh that would brighten anyone’s day.Service Information
